Researchers have unveiled a new computational imaging technique that significantly lowers the radiation dose required for X-ray imaging while maintaining high image quality. This advancement could revolutionize the field of medical diagnostics.
The method utilizes advanced algorithms to enhance image clarity, enabling clear visualization of internal structures with reduced risk to patients. This is particularly important in medical settings where repeated X-ray examinations are common.
As the technology continues to develop, it holds the potential to make X-ray diagnostics safer and more accessible, ultimately benefiting a larger population by minimizing the risks associated with radiation exposure.
